Who is Camille Munday?

Camille Munday is a U.S.-based motherhood and lifestyle content creator known for sharing honest, family-centered stories across TikTok and Instagram. She documents her journey through infertility, parenting, and life with a blended family, building a community grounded in openness and support.

Camille Munday: Leading Motherhood Conversations Through Family-Centered Content

‍

‍

Camille Munday is a content creator who has built her online presence around her journey with infertility, blended family life, and motherhood. She speaks openly about her experience becoming a mother after infertility struggles, using the phrase “Infertility sucks!!!” as her profile message. Her storytelling is raw yet uplifting, resonating strongly with women navigating similar personal battles. Camille doesn’t present a filtered version of family life — she shares its challenges head-on.

‍

What makes Camille stand out is her ability to represent blended families authentically. She frequently features her husband and children in posts, discussing co-parenting, family structure, and the realities of raising kids in a non-traditional household. Her openness helps normalize conversations that many creators shy away from. This approach makes her a trusted voice among parents who value honesty over curation.

TikTok: Her Biggest Platform for Relatable Family Content

‍

‍

Camille Munday’s TikTok presence (@camille_munday) centers on her identity as a mom navigating the chaos and charm of family life. With 1.7M followers and a steady 0.49% engagement rate, she connects through unfiltered content—rarely relying on trending sounds or overly produced visuals. Her videos often begin mid-moment, capturing raw, unscripted glimpses into her day-to-day, whether it's wiping sticky hands or reacting to something her daughter Lennon says. This “real-first” aesthetic makes her content scroll-stopping even in a saturated niche.

‍

Camille’s strength lies in her ability to balance vulnerability and humor. She’s open about infertility challenges, blending those reflections with moments of lightness like TikToks featuring her husband Taylor or toddler skits with Lennon. These posts resonate most because they’re framed through her personal lens—not just parenting, but her parenting. Her willingness to share real-life highs and lows sets her apart from creators who only showcase the polished version of motherhood.

‍

‍

Her average content performance—164.6K views and 8.3K engagements per post—demonstrates that consistency matters more than virality in her case. Posting five times a week, Camille’s uploads serve more like check-ins than “content drops,” helping her maintain visibility without relying on growth spikes. She doesn’t chase TikTok trends; instead, she builds her own format: direct-to-camera talks, outfit rundowns, and family check-ins. That predictability becomes part of her brand’s comfort appeal.

‍

Although she hasn’t gained new followers in the past month, Camille’s viewership hasn’t dipped. Her audience doesn’t just follow—they return. That repeat engagement suggests a loyal base who views her content as part of their routine. Rather than pivoting for growth, Camille leans into audience retention, using TikTok less as a launchpad and more as a living journal of her family’s evolving story.

Instagram: A Visual Diary of Motherhood

‍

‍

Camille Munday’s Instagram (@camille_munday) operates as the polished counterpart to her candid TikTok feed. With 272.8K followers and a strong 1.24% engagement rate, her posts lean into lifestyle visuals—family portraits on milestone days, polished selfies, and clean flat-lays that reflect her aesthetic sense. Despite the curated nature of the content, Camille maintains relatability by pairing picture-perfect visuals with heartfelt or humorous captions. Her feed serves as a digital scrapbook that balances family-first branding with audience connection.

‍

She averages nine posts per month and uses the grid primarily for storytelling, not trend-chasing. Posts like her daughter Lennon’s preschool graduation or her own reflections on parenting teens through toddlers show Camille’s range across motherhood stages. These posts are rarely generic; they tie into her own journey and often highlight the realities of being a young mom managing a blended household. That specificity—young family, multiple ages, clean aesthetic—is key to why her content feels tailored, not templated.

‍

‍

Her brand partnerships are integrated with notable finesse. Sponsors like Bloom Nutrition and Clarins USA appear regularly, but never in a way that overshadows the family dynamic. For instance, she’ll mention using a product as part of her nighttime routine after wrangling the kids, or include it in a candid story-time video about motherhood stress. This subtle product placement strategy makes her collaborations feel like part of her life, rather than interruptions to it.

‍

Camille’s Instagram Stories are where she truly opens up day-to-day. She frequently shares parenting anecdotes, mini-hauls, and behind-the-scenes glimpses of chaotic mornings or sweet sibling moments. This layer of spontaneous, personal storytelling reinforces her credibility as both a creator and a mom. With growth at +2.54% over the past month, Camille is not just maintaining her following—she’s steadily expanding a community that finds comfort and resonance in her lived experience.
